5 best security lights

Stay safe and secure with this selection of outdoor motion-sensor lights

By Jenny Mcfarlane | 8 July 2019

One of the most effective ways to add security to your home, as well as a feature that can come in handy for al fresco living, the very best outdoor sensor lights can be a real boon as part of your home design.

From super-sensitive lights made to warn off intruders – whether human or animal – to softer lights that combine alertness with good looks, Grand Designs magazine picks five of the best…

1. Ring Floodlight Cam

Ring take a ‘bells and whistles’ approach to home security lights, with features galore. Much more than just a motion-activated light, the Ring Floodlight Cam (£249.99) comes with a HD camera, siren and two-way communication so you can talk to visitors.

If you’re away, it will send alerts to your phone or tablet whenever someone enters your grounds, so you can check the on-demand video and, if you desire, trigger a siren. In other words, it does pretty much everything except bark like a dog.

2. Steinel LED Floodlight

Steinel have some cheaper entries in this market, but you definitely get what you pay for when it comes to security lights. The Steinel XLED Home 2XL (£116.99) is available in a range of colours to blend in with your exterior, and also available without motion sensor detection.

It has a homogeneous and pleasant light for the eyes thanks to the noble LED panel in opal optics and 4000 K neutral-white light colour. It delivers a pretty intense light for a product that prides itself on low energy use.

3. Philips Welcome Outdoor Floodlight

Equipped with Hue technology and a powerful LED, the Welcome Outdoor Floodlight from Philips provides a bright and large illumination for your outdoor spaces. Experience seamless, smart control when you connect it to the Philips Hue Bridge.

To create a more innovative look, this light has been designed to incorporate the LED within it. This LED is not replaceable but has a lifespan of up to 30,000 hours.

4. MPOW solar-powered security lights

MPOW solar-powered security lights have a conversion rate of about 35%, allowing a faster charging. They can also be used at night, thanks to the 1200mAH battery. They have an eight-metre detection range and an IP65 rating, meaning they are waterproof. Priced £25.99 for a pack of four.

5. Mr Beams MB393 Ultra Bright Spotlight

Mr Beams MB393 battery-powered spotlights are an ideal quick-fix home security solution. Priced £60.02, they come in a pack of three and have a one-year battery life. They are simple to install, adjustable, bright (300 Lumens) and waterproof.
